47 /**
48 Adds a record into S3 boot script table.
49
50 This function is used to store a boot script record into a given boot
51 script table. If the table specified by TableName is nonexistent in the
52 system, a new table will automatically be created and then the script record
53 will be added into the new table. This function is responsible for allocating
54 necessary memory for the script.
55
56 This function has a variable parameter list. The exact parameter list depends on
57 the OpCode that is passed into the function. If an unsupported OpCode or illegal
58 parameter list is passed in, this function returns EFI_INVALID_PARAMETER.
59 If there are not enough resources available for storing more scripts, this function returns
60 EFI_OUT_OF_RESOURCES.
61
62 @param This A pointer to the EFI_S3_SAVE_STATE_PROTOCOL instance.
63 @param OpCode The operation code (opcode) number.
64 @param ... Argument list that is specific to each opcode.
65
66 @retval EFI_SUCCESS The operation succeeded. A record was added into the
67 specified script table.
68 @retval EFI_INVALID_PARAMETER The parameter is illegal or the given boot script is not supported.
69 If the opcode is unknow or not supported because of the PCD
70 Feature Flags.
71 @retval EFI_OUT_OF_RESOURCES There is insufficient memory to store the boot script.
72
73 **/
74 EFI_STATUS
75 EFIAPI
76 BootScriptWrite (
77 IN CONST EFI_S3_SAVE_STATE_PROTOCOL *This,
78 IN UINT16 OpCode,
79 ...
80 );
81 /**
82 Insert a record into a specified Framework boot script table.
83
84 This function is used to store an OpCode to be replayed as part of the S3 resume boot path. It is
85 assumed this protocol has platform specific mechanism to store the OpCode set and replay them
86 during the S3 resume.
87 The opcode is inserted before or after the specified position in the boot script table. If Position is
88 NULL then that position is after the last opcode in the table (BeforeOrAfter is FALSE) or before
89 the first opcode in the table (BeforeOrAfter is TRUE). The position which is pointed to by
90 Position upon return can be used for subsequent insertions.
91
92 @param This A pointer to the EFI_S3_SAVE_STATE_PROTOCOL instance.
93 @param BeforeOrAfter Specifies whether the opcode is stored before (TRUE) or after (FALSE) the position
94 in the boot script table specified by Position. If Position is NULL or points to
95 NULL then the new opcode is inserted at the beginning of the table (if TRUE) or end
96 of the table (if FALSE).
97 @param Position On entry, specifies the position in the boot script table where the opcode will be
98 inserted, either before or after, depending on BeforeOrAfter. On exit, specifies
99 the position of the inserted opcode in the boot script table.
100 @param OpCode The operation code (opcode) number.
101 @param ... Argument list that is specific to each opcode.
102
103 @retval EFI_SUCCESS The operation succeeded. A record was added into the
104 specified script table.
105 @retval EFI_INVALID_PARAMETER The Opcode is an invalid opcode value or the Position is not a valid position in the boot script table..
106 @retval EFI_OUT_OF_RESOURCES There is insufficient memory to store the boot script.
107
108 **/
109 EFI_STATUS
110 EFIAPI
111 BootScriptInsert (
112 IN CONST EFI_S3_SAVE_STATE_PROTOCOL *This,
113 IN BOOLEAN BeforeOrAfter,
114 IN OUT EFI_S3_BOOT_SCRIPT_POSITION *Position OPTIONAL,
115 IN UINT16 OpCode,
116 ...
117 );
118 /**
119 Find a label within the boot script table and, if not present, optionally create it.
120
121 If the label Label is already exists in the boot script table, then no new label is created, the
122 position of the Label is returned in *Position and EFI_SUCCESS is returned.
123 If the label Label does not already exist and CreateIfNotFound is TRUE, then it will be
124 created before or after the specified position and EFI_SUCCESS is returned.
125 If the label Label does not already exist and CreateIfNotFound is FALSE, then
126 EFI_NOT_FOUND is returned.
127
128 @param This A pointer to the EFI_S3_SAVE_STATE_PROTOCOL instance.
129 @param BeforeOrAfter Specifies whether the label is stored before (TRUE) or after (FALSE) the position in
130 the boot script table specified by Position. If Position is NULL or points to
131 NULL then the new label is inserted at the beginning of the table (if TRUE) or end of
132 the table (if FALSE).
133 @param CreateIfNotFound Specifies whether the label will be created if the label does not exists (TRUE) or not
134 (FALSE).
135 @param Position On entry, specifies the position in the boot script table where the label will be inserted,
136 either before or after, depending on BeforeOrAfter. On exit, specifies the position
137 of the inserted label in the boot script table.
138 @param Label Points to the label which will be inserted in the boot script table.
139
140 @retval EFI_SUCCESS The label already exists or was inserted.
141 @retval EFI_INVALID_PARAMETER The Opcode is an invalid opcode value or the Position is not a valid position in the boot script table..
142
143 **/
144 EFI_STATUS
145 EFIAPI
146 BootScriptLabel (
147 IN CONST EFI_S3_SAVE_STATE_PROTOCOL *This,
148 IN BOOLEAN BeforeOrAfter,
149 IN BOOLEAN CreateIfNotFound,
150 IN OUT EFI_S3_BOOT_SCRIPT_POSITION *Position OPTIONAL,
151 IN CONST CHAR8 *Label
152 );
153 /**
154 Compare two positions in the boot script table and return their relative position.
155
156 This function compares two positions in the boot script table and returns their relative positions. If
157 Position1 is before Position2, then -1 is returned. If Position1 is equal to Position2,
158 then 0 is returned. If Position1 is after Position2, then 1 is returned.
159
160 @param This A pointer to the EFI_S3_SAVE_STATE_PROTOCOL instance.
161 @param Position1 The positions in the boot script table to compare
162 @param Position2 The positions in the boot script table to compare
163 @param RelativePosition On return, points to the result of the comparison
164
165 @retval EFI_SUCCESS The operation succeeded.
166 @retval EFI_INVALID_PARAMETER The Position1 or Position2 is not a valid position in the boot script table.
167
168 **/
169 EFI_STATUS
170 EFIAPI
171 BootScriptCompare (
172 IN CONST EFI_S3_SAVE_STATE_PROTOCOL *This,
173 IN EFI_S3_BOOT_SCRIPT_POSITION Position1,
174 IN EFI_S3_BOOT_SCRIPT_POSITION Position2,
175 OUT UINTN *RelativePosition
176 );
